baid              744 drivers/net/wireless/intel/iwlwifi/fw/api/rx.h 	u8 baid;
baid              726 drivers/net/wireless/intel/iwlwifi/mvm/mvm.h 	u8 baid;
baid              515 drivers/net/wireless/intel/iwlwifi/mvm/rxmq.c static void iwl_mvm_sync_nssn(struct iwl_mvm *mvm, u8 baid, u16 nssn)
baid              521 drivers/net/wireless/intel/iwlwifi/mvm/rxmq.c 			.nssn_sync.baid = baid,
baid              575 drivers/net/wireless/intel/iwlwifi/mvm/rxmq.c 			iwl_mvm_sync_nssn(mvm, baid_data->baid, ssn);
baid              684 drivers/net/wireless/intel/iwlwifi/mvm/rxmq.c 	u8 baid = data->baid;
baid              686 drivers/net/wireless/intel/iwlwifi/mvm/rxmq.c 	if (WARN_ONCE(baid >= IWL_MAX_BAID, "invalid BAID: %x\n", baid))
baid              691 drivers/net/wireless/intel/iwlwifi/mvm/rxmq.c 	ba_data = rcu_dereference(mvm->baid_map[baid]);
baid              716 drivers/net/wireless/intel/iwlwifi/mvm/rxmq.c 					      u8 baid, u16 nssn, int queue,
baid              724 drivers/net/wireless/intel/iwlwifi/mvm/rxmq.c 		     baid, nssn);
baid              726 drivers/net/wireless/intel/iwlwifi/mvm/rxmq.c 	if (WARN_ON_ONCE(baid == IWL_RX_REORDER_DATA_INVALID_BAID ||
baid              727 drivers/net/wireless/intel/iwlwifi/mvm/rxmq.c 			 baid >= ARRAY_SIZE(mvm->baid_map)))
baid              732 drivers/net/wireless/intel/iwlwifi/mvm/rxmq.c 	ba_data = rcu_dereference(mvm->baid_map[baid]);
baid              755 drivers/net/wireless/intel/iwlwifi/mvm/rxmq.c 	iwl_mvm_release_frames_from_notif(mvm, napi, data->baid,
baid              871 drivers/net/wireless/intel/iwlwifi/mvm/rxmq.c 	u8 baid;
baid              873 drivers/net/wireless/intel/iwlwifi/mvm/rxmq.c 	baid = (reorder & IWL_RX_MPDU_REORDER_BAID_MASK) >>
baid              883 drivers/net/wireless/intel/iwlwifi/mvm/rxmq.c 	if (baid == IWL_RX_REORDER_DATA_INVALID_BAID)
baid              902 drivers/net/wireless/intel/iwlwifi/mvm/rxmq.c 	baid_data = rcu_dereference(mvm->baid_map[baid]);
baid              906 drivers/net/wireless/intel/iwlwifi/mvm/rxmq.c 			      baid, reorder);
baid              912 drivers/net/wireless/intel/iwlwifi/mvm/rxmq.c 		 baid, baid_data->sta_id, baid_data->tid, mvm_sta->sta_id,
baid              983 drivers/net/wireless/intel/iwlwifi/mvm/rxmq.c 				iwl_mvm_sync_nssn(mvm, baid, sn);
baid             1002 drivers/net/wireless/intel/iwlwifi/mvm/rxmq.c 				iwl_mvm_sync_nssn(mvm, baid, sn);
baid             1063 drivers/net/wireless/intel/iwlwifi/mvm/rxmq.c 				    u32 reorder_data, u8 baid)
baid             1071 drivers/net/wireless/intel/iwlwifi/mvm/rxmq.c 	data = rcu_dereference(mvm->baid_map[baid]);
baid             1075 drivers/net/wireless/intel/iwlwifi/mvm/rxmq.c 			      baid, reorder_data);
baid             1735 drivers/net/wireless/intel/iwlwifi/mvm/rxmq.c 		u8 baid = (u8)((le32_to_cpu(desc->reorder_data) &
baid             1807 drivers/net/wireless/intel/iwlwifi/mvm/rxmq.c 		if (baid != IWL_RX_REORDER_DATA_INVALID_BAID) {
baid             1810 drivers/net/wireless/intel/iwlwifi/mvm/rxmq.c 			iwl_mvm_agg_rx_received(mvm, reorder_data, baid);
baid             2024 drivers/net/wireless/intel/iwlwifi/mvm/rxmq.c 	iwl_mvm_release_frames_from_notif(mvm, napi, release->baid,
baid             2034 drivers/net/wireless/intel/iwlwifi/mvm/rxmq.c 	unsigned int baid = le32_get_bits(release->ba_info,
baid             2044 drivers/net/wireless/intel/iwlwifi/mvm/rxmq.c 	if (WARN_ON_ONCE(baid == IWL_RX_REORDER_DATA_INVALID_BAID ||
baid             2045 drivers/net/wireless/intel/iwlwifi/mvm/rxmq.c 			 baid >= ARRAY_SIZE(mvm->baid_map)))
baid             2049 drivers/net/wireless/intel/iwlwifi/mvm/rxmq.c 	baid_data = rcu_dereference(mvm->baid_map[baid]);
baid             2053 drivers/net/wireless/intel/iwlwifi/mvm/rxmq.c 			      baid);
baid             2059 drivers/net/wireless/intel/iwlwifi/mvm/rxmq.c 		 baid, baid_data->sta_id, baid_data->tid, sta_id,
baid             2063 drivers/net/wireless/intel/iwlwifi/mvm/rxmq.c 	iwl_mvm_release_frames_from_notif(mvm, napi, baid, nssn, queue, 0);
baid             2443 drivers/net/wireless/intel/iwlwifi/mvm/sta.c static void iwl_mvm_sync_rxq_del_ba(struct iwl_mvm *mvm, u8 baid)
baid             2448 drivers/net/wireless/intel/iwlwifi/mvm/sta.c 		.delba.baid = baid,
baid             2458 drivers/net/wireless/intel/iwlwifi/mvm/sta.c 	iwl_mvm_sync_rxq_del_ba(mvm, data->baid);
baid             2621 drivers/net/wireless/intel/iwlwifi/mvm/sta.c 		u8 baid;
baid             2632 drivers/net/wireless/intel/iwlwifi/mvm/sta.c 		baid = (u8)((status & IWL_ADD_STA_BAID_MASK) >>
baid             2634 drivers/net/wireless/intel/iwlwifi/mvm/sta.c 		baid_data->baid = baid;
baid             2637 drivers/net/wireless/intel/iwlwifi/mvm/sta.c 		baid_data->rcu_ptr = &mvm->baid_map[baid];
baid             2644 drivers/net/wireless/intel/iwlwifi/mvm/sta.c 		mvm_sta->tid_to_baid[tid] = baid;
baid             2657 drivers/net/wireless/intel/iwlwifi/mvm/sta.c 			     mvm_sta->sta_id, tid, baid);
baid             2658 drivers/net/wireless/intel/iwlwifi/mvm/sta.c 		WARN_ON(rcu_access_pointer(mvm->baid_map[baid]));
baid             2659 drivers/net/wireless/intel/iwlwifi/mvm/sta.c 		rcu_assign_pointer(mvm->baid_map[baid], baid_data);
baid             2661 drivers/net/wireless/intel/iwlwifi/mvm/sta.c 		u8 baid = mvm_sta->tid_to_baid[tid];
baid             2669 drivers/net/wireless/intel/iwlwifi/mvm/sta.c 		if (WARN_ON(baid == IWL_RX_REORDER_DATA_INVALID_BAID))
baid             2672 drivers/net/wireless/intel/iwlwifi/mvm/sta.c 		baid_data = rcu_access_pointer(mvm->baid_map[baid]);
baid             2679 drivers/net/wireless/intel/iwlwifi/mvm/sta.c 		RCU_INIT_POINTER(mvm->baid_map[baid], NULL);
baid             2681 drivers/net/wireless/intel/iwlwifi/mvm/sta.c 		IWL_DEBUG_HT(mvm, "BAID %d is free\n", baid);
baid              343 drivers/net/wireless/intel/iwlwifi/mvm/sta.h 	u32 baid;
baid              347 drivers/net/wireless/intel/iwlwifi/mvm/sta.h 	u32 baid;